How to Install DIY Recessed Lighting in the Kitchen

Do-it-yourself recessed lights add a nice additional touch to your kitchen. Recessed lights are attached directly to your ceiling. If you want something that’s clever looking with modern details, then you might consider recessed lights around your kitchen. Installing this kind of lighting is not necessarily a beginner’s DIY kitchen project. Step 1: Do Your Spot Checks

Create a lighting plan. Mark the location of where your recessed lights will be installed. Use the laser level to make sure that the markings are in a straight line. Using a coat hanger, poke the marks to make sure the area is strong enough to support the DIY lights so that they won’t just fall on a joist. Make sure to do any adjustments needed before starting to your DIY light installation.

Step 2: Cut the Holes

After making the guide marks and checking the spots, you can now make a hole for your recessed lights. Make a hole on the ceiling following the marks by using a drill with a hole saw attachment. Then set the recessed lights in place and tightly nail them to the joists. Make sure to strip the end of the wire with a wire stripper.

Step 3: Feed Wires through the Connector

When you’re done setting your recessed lights, remove the cap from the light fixture and snap the easy connector into the light fixture. Put the connector in both sets of wire and insert the clip from the side and squeeze it with pliers.

Step 4: Connect the Wires

The last part of installing your DIY recessed lights involves setting up all the wires and connectors. To do that, push the ends of the wires into the wire connector. Put all the wiring back in the box and put on the cover plate. Lastly, snap the trim kits on the lights. And now, you can enjoy your clever looking recessed lights on your kitchen!

Safety Note:

  • Don’t forget to wear necessary protective gear when working around insulation.

  • Make sure to get expert assistance if you don’t know how to use the equipment.
